[Bizgres-general] Question: Is 64-bit cache support valuable?

Simon Riggs simon at 2ndquadrant.com
Sun Sep 25 20:10:00 GMT 2005


On Sat, 2005-09-24 at 16:32 -0500, Jim C. Nasby wrote:

> On Thu, Jul 21, 2005 at 07:39:15PM +0100, Simon Riggs wrote:
> > >  I'd narrow down 
> > > the critical features to:
> > > 
> > > 1. Allow 64-bit work_mem (and maintenance_work_mem) allocation.
> > > 2. Add a total_work_mem limit which would be tracked for work_mem, 
> > > maintenance_work_mem, and temp_buffers.
> > > 3. Add a system where processes requesting over the limit or total_work_mem 
> > > would block and wait.
> > > 
> > > I think that would be enough code for a first, useful implementation and 
> > > further improvements would be suggested by the users/results.   Adding the 
> > > hooks for centralized tracking and management of allocated memory will be 
> > > enough code as it is.
> > 
> > I'll move to -hackers for the more detailed aspects, once 8.1 beta is
> > out.
> > 
> This hasn't gone to -hackers yet, right?

We've had a discussion around this and the complexities of achieving
this with the current codebase. For now, this idea has been shelved but
not dismissed entirely.

Best Regards, Simon Riggs




More information about the Bizgres-general mailing list